1If the LORD had not been on our side— let Israel now declare—
2if the LORD had not been on our side when men attacked us,
3when their anger flared against us, then they would have swallowed us alive,
4then the floods would have engulfed us, then the torrent would have overwhelmed us,
5then the raging waters would have swept us away.
6Blessed be the LORD, who has not given us as prey to their teeth.
7We have escaped like a bird from the snare of the fowler; the net is torn, and we have slipped away.
8Our help is in the name of the LORD, the Maker of heaven and earth.
